Creative Drama Workshop
This workshop is open to anybody age 7 and over, including teens and
adults. The maximum number of participants is 20.
In 2010, the camp runs from Monday, August 9th
to Friday, August 27th, weekdays only from 9 am to 12 noon.
|
|
|
The
first week will focus on creative activities using spontaneous
movement, the imagination, the voice, the senses, emotions and
conflict, and character building.
The
second and third weeks will include bringing interesting facts and
ideas to life on the stage, using the skills learned.
Participants
will work together on short sketches and scenes that will be presented
to parents and friends on the last day of the workshop.
